The Best Cowboy Cookies

History and Origin

Cowboy Cookies are a classic American cookie with roots that are believed to trace back to the Western frontier. These cookies were likely named after cowboys who needed hearty, portable snacks during long cattle drives. The cookies’ robust nature made them perfect for packing along on long journeys, providing energy and satisfaction. Over time, the recipe has evolved, but it has always retained the core elements of oats, chocolate chips, and nuts, which make them both filling and flavorful. Cowboy Cookies became particularly famous when First Lady Laura Bush’s recipe won a cookie bake-off during the 2000 presidential campaign, cementing their place in American culinary tradition.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ened: Provides the rich, buttery base for the cookie dough, contributing to the cookies’ tender texture.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ar: Adds sweetness and helps achieve a crisp edge on the cookies.
  • 1 cup packed light brown sugar: Adds moisture, sweetness, and a slight caramel flavor that complements the other ingredients.
  • 2 large eggs, at room temperature: Help bind the ingredients together and add moisture to the dough.
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ract: Enhances the overall flavor of the cookies.
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our: Forms the structure of the cookies.
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der: Aids in the cookies’ rise, giving them a light and fluffy texture.
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da: Works with the baking powder to ensure the cookies rise properly while spreading just the right amount.
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on: Adds warmth and depth of flavor.
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g: Provides a subtle, aromatic spice that complements the cinnamon.
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t: Balances the sweetness and enhances the flavors.
  • 2 cups old-fashioned oats: Add texture and a chewy bite to the cookies.
  • 1 1/2 cups sweetened shredded coconut: Provides a sweet, tropical flavor and chewy texture.
  • 1 1/2 cups semisweet chocolate chips: Add a rich, chocolatey goodness to every bite.
  • 1 cup chopped pecans: Offer a nutty crunch that contrasts with the other soft ingredients.

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Dough:
    •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per to prevent sticking and ensure even baking.
    • In a large bowl, beat together the softened butter, granulated sugar, and light brown sugar. Use an electric mixer on medium speed to cream the mixture until it becomes light and fluffy, about 3-4 minutes.
    • Add in the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. This ensures the eggs are fully incorporated into the dough.
    • Stir in the vanilla extract until evenly mixed.
  2. Mix Dry Ingredients:
    • In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king powder, baking soda, ground cinnamon, ground nutmeg, and salt. Ensure that the spices and leavening agents are evenly distributed throughout the flour.
    •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ing on low speed or by hand until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can lead to tough cookies.
  3. Add Mix-Ins:
    • Stir in the old-fashioned oats, shredded coconut, semisweet chocolate chips, and chopped pecans. Make sure all the mix-ins are evenly distributed throughout the dough for consistent flavor in every cookie.
  4. Shape and Bake:
    • Using a cookie scoop or two tablespoons, portion the dough into 2-tablespoon-sized balls. Place the dough balls on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art to allow for spreading during baking.
    •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ges of the cookies are lightly golden. The centers may still appear slightly soft, but they will firm up as the cookies cool.
    •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for about 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
  5. Serve and Enjoy:
    • Once cooled, the cookies are ready to serve. Enjoy them with a glass of cold milk, a cup of coffee, or just on their own.

Variations of the Recipe

  • Gluten-Free Cowboy Cookies: Substitute the all-purpose flour with a gluten-free flour blend. Ensure that the oats used are also certified gluten-free.
  • Nut-Free Option: Omit the pecans if you’re catering to someone with a nut allergy, or replace them with sunflower seeds or extra chocolate chips.
  • White Chocolate and Cranberry: Swap the semisweet chocolate chips for white chocolate chips and replace the pecans with dried cranberries for a festive twist.
  • Spiced Cowboy Cookies: Increase the amount of cinnamon and nutmeg, and add a pinch of ground cloves or allspice for a more spiced version.

FAQs

  1. Can I freeze the cookie dough? Yes, you can freeze the dough. Scoop the dough into balls, place them on a baking sheet, and freeze until solid. Then transfer the dough balls to a freezer bag. When ready to bake, you can bake them straight from frozen, just add a couple of minutes to the baking time.
  2. How long will the cookies stay fresh? Stored in an airtight container at room temperature, Cowboy Cookies will stay fresh for about 4-5 days. For longer storage, you can freeze the baked cookies for up to 3 months.
  3. Can I substitute the pecans with other nuts? Absolutely! Walnuts, almonds, or even macadamia nuts would be great substitutes for pecans.
  4. Is it necessary to chill the dough before baking? Chilling the dough is not required for this recipe, but if you find your cookies are spreading too much, chilling the dough for 30 minutes before baking can help.
  5. What if I don’t have sweetened coconut? You can use unsweetened shredded coconut if you prefer a less sweet cookie. The texture will remain the same, though the overall sweetness will be reduced.
